Skip to content

Commit 9588aed

Browse files
committed
chore(semantic-release): init
1 parent 2a75904 commit 9588aed

File tree

3 files changed

+2006
-11
lines changed

3 files changed

+2006
-11
lines changed

.circleci/config.yml

+13
Original file line numberDiff line numberDiff line change
@@ -63,6 +63,15 @@ jobs:
6363
- run:
6464
name: Test
6565
command: ./scripts/runCypressCi.sh --browser=chrome
66+
release:
67+
<<: *defaults
68+
steps:
69+
- restore_cache:
70+
keys:
71+
- v1-repo-{{ .Revision }}
72+
- run:
73+
name: Release
74+
command: npm run release || true
6675

6776
workflows:
6877
version: 2
@@ -78,3 +87,7 @@ workflows:
7887
- test:
7988
requires:
8089
- buildDemo
90+
- release:
91+
requires:
92+
- test
93+
- lint

0 commit comments

Comments
 (0)